Itinerary
We will pick you all up at your hotel; transportation is arranged by us. Once you arrive at Sosua Bay beach, you can enjoy the scenery while boarding the Tip Top catamaran. You will board a lancha to reach the catamaran.
Climb aboard the largest catamaran on the north coast, 75 feet long, take a seat on the comfortable and spacious nets of the Tip Top, and sail to two fantastic snorkeling spots. We will provide you with the necessary equipment to explore the seabed, including fins, snorkel, and mask. The fish-rich seawater of Sosua will surprise you. Our team of professionals on board is there for your safety, which is our motto! A generous Dominican lunch is served on board and you will have access to an open bar throughout the trip—it's your moment. The atmosphere is always excellent and ideal for opening the sails to Puerto Plata. Get ready for two hours of fun.
You will disembark at the marina of the famous Ocean World park. You will then be taken back to your respective accommodations, all of which will be arranged by us.

This boat day was SO much fun. There are a lot of people on the boat, so expect a very social, lively environment. You’ll likely be sharing tables and space with others, and there aren’t really quiet or private areas. That said, if you’re open to it, it really adds to the experience. The crew completely made the trip. They were hilarious, engaging, and did an amazing job getting everyone involved—dancing, laughing, and just having a great time. Huge shoutout to Benjamin and Mawii (the photographer), who were especially fun and added a lot to the vibe. The day starts with two snorkeling stops. You can fully snorkel with equipment, just swim, or even stay on the boat if that’s more your speed. My friends and I chose to just get in the water and swim, which was perfect. Life jackets are provided and required in the water, but not while you’re on the boat. After snorkeling, the open bar kicks in and you cruise while eating and drinking. The food was buffet-style, with plenty of options and generous portions—you can go back for as much as you want. A couple practical tips: • There are bathrooms on board • Definitely bring sunscreen and a towel • Take motion sickness medication beforehand—this is a big one Even if you’re comfortable on boats, the waves can be intense. I grew up on the water on a boat every weekend in Florida and still took Bonine beforehand, and I’m really glad I did. I felt completely fine, but probably a third of the boat got seasick. The crew does their best to help (cold washcloths, crackers, water, buckets, etc.), but it’s much better to prevent it. Bonine is great because it doesn’t have noticeable side effects, so it’s 100% worth taking as a just in case. Overall, I would definitely recommend this experience. It’s high-energy, social, and just a really fun way to spend a day on the water.
